We're thrilled to announce the Center for Therapeutic Genetics (CTG), a new collaboration between JAX, the Broad Institute of MIT and Harvard and the Boston Children's Hospital — a collaboration that will develop genetic medicines and treat patients with rare disease — not as one-off breakthroughs, but as a repeatable practice. An estimated 350–400 million people worldwide live with one of approximately 8,000 rare diseases. Fewer than 1 in 20 has an approved treatment. Recent advances in programmable genetic medicines, including base and prime editing, are paving the way toward a new model for treating rare disease. These medicines that can be tailored to the specific mutation that causes a given condition. Central to CTG is a platform strategy in which design tools, disease models, manufacturing processes, safety data, and clinical protocols developed for one program are shared across multiple disease programs — making genetic medicine faster, safer, less costly, and more accessible to patients. The center is founded by pioneers in genetic medicine and long-standing scientific collaborators, including Cat Lutz, Vice President, JAX Rare Disease Translational Center; David R. Liu of the Broad Institute; Timothy Yu and Wendy Chung of Boston Children’s Hospital; and Winston Yan, Director of CTG.
